Electric vehicle competition intensifies in Brazil

The Brazilian electric vehicle market is seeing increased competition as new compact models prepare to challenge the BYD Dolphin Mini.

At the Interlagos Festival 2026, Dongfeng (operating as DFM in Brazil) introduced the Box Urban, an all-electric compact hatchback. The model offers an autonomy of up to 302 km and is part of a broader market entry strategy that includes a planned network of 60 dealerships and a 10-year warranty. Dongfeng also presented the Vigo Urban Plus, an SUV designed to compete with models from BYD and GWM.

Additionally, the Wuling Bingo Pro is expected to enter the Brazilian market by 2027, potentially integrated into the Chevrolet lineup. Speculation suggests the model could revive the Celta nameplate. The Bingo Pro is estimated to cost approximately R$ 120,000 and features a 380-liter trunk, which is significantly larger than the 230-liter capacity of the BYD Dolphin Mini. The vehicle is expected to offer an autonomy range between 330 km and 403 km.
